- WIB (UTC+7): Covers Jakarta and most of the islands of Sumatra, Java, and Kalimantan (Indonesian Borneo).
- WITA (Central Indonesian Time, UTC+8): Covers Sulawesi, Bali, Nusa Tenggara, and parts of Kalimantan.
- WIT (Eastern Indonesian Time, UTC+9): Covers Maluku, Papua, and some surrounding islands.

Understanding Jakarta Time: The Basics
First things first: Jakarta operates on Western Indonesian Time (WIB). This time zone is UTC+7 (Coordinated Universal Time plus 7 hours). That means when it's noon in London, it's 7 PM in Jakarta. Easy peasy, right? This time zone governs not just Jakarta, but also a large swathe of western Indonesia, including major cities like Surabaya and Medan. Time Zones Explained: WIB and Beyond
Let's get a little deeper into the world of time zones. As mentioned earlier, Jakarta runs on Western Indonesian Time (WIB), which is UTC+7. But Indonesia is a vast country, and it actually has three different time zones. The purpose of this system is to better fit the daily sun cycle within a geographical area. This can avoid confusion among citizens. Here's a quick rundown:

It's also worth noting that Indonesia does not observe Daylight Saving Time (DST). So, the time difference between Jakarta and other countries will remain consistent throughout the year. While DST is common in many parts of the world, Indonesia keeps things simple by sticking to a standard time year-round.
